WHAT WILL YOUR M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ES BE

  • Executive Procurement sourcing strategy: Decides what to buy, where to buy, how to buy, when to buy and Source all Raw and packaging materials required for the business
  • following the Unilever established Supplier qualification requirements, adhering to the systems & process.
  • Ensuring materials availability per the service level
  • Critical for Day-to-day operations risk management i.e. Early identification of issues within the supply chain and supporting its resolution; with alternative sourcing solutions, dispute mediation.
  • Interacting with all relevant stakeholders to get the required support & approvals in sourcing materials.
  • follow market conditions, prepare price trends, and formulate future markets trends for the business.
  • Support the business with accurate price forecasting. Prepares information on cost inflation, prices, and conditions to enable proper financial / cost forecasting.
  • Ensure 100% contract compliance.
  • Supplier collaboration and innovation
  • Support category in development of innovation projects
  • Negotiate the best deal for pricing and supply contracts.
  • Maintain and update a list of suppliers and their qualifications, delivery times, and potential future development
  • Support in Resilience and supplier development for key materials
